class SinglelineLabel implements Labeltype {
private void align( PGraphics theGraphics , int theAlignX , int theAlignY , int theW , int theH ) {
int x = 0;
int y = 0;
switch ( theAlignX ) {
case ( ControlP5.CENTER ):
x = ( theW - _myFontLabel.getWidth( ) ) / 2;
break;
case ( ControlP5.LEFT ):
x = _myPaddingX;
break;
case ( ControlP5.RIGHT ):
x = theW - _myFontLabel.getWidth( ) - _myPaddingX;
break;
case ( ControlP5.LEFT_OUTSIDE ):
x = -_myFontLabel.getWidth( ) - _myPaddingX;
break;
case ( ControlP5.RIGHT_OUTSIDE ):
x = theW + _myPaddingX;
break;
}
switch ( theAlignY ) {
case ( ControlP5.CENTER ):
y = theH / 2 + _myFontLabel.getTop( ) - _myFontLabel.getCenter( );
break;
case ( ControlP5.TOP ):
y = 0;
break;
case ( ControlP5.BOTTOM ):
y = theH - _myFontLabel.getHeight( ) - 1;
break;
case ( ControlP5.BASELINE ):
y = theH + _myFontLabel.getTop( ) - 1;
break;
case ( ControlP5.BOTTOM_OUTSIDE ):
y = theH + _myPaddingY;
break;
case ( ControlP5.TOP_OUTSIDE ):
y = -_myFontLabel.getHeight( ) - _myPaddingY;
break;
}
theGraphics.translate( x , y );
}
@Override public void draw( Label theLabel , PGraphics theGraphics , int theX , int theY , int theW , int theH ) {
_myFontLabel.adjust( theGraphics , theLabel );
theGraphics.pushMatrix( );
align( theGraphics , alignX , alignY , theW , theH );
theLabel.draw( theGraphics , theX , theY );
theGraphics.popMatrix( );
}
@Override public void draw( Label theLabel , PGraphics theGraphics , int theX , int theY , ControllerInterface< ? > theController ) {
draw( theLabel , theGraphics , theX , theY , theController.getWidth( ) , theController.getHeight( ) );
}
@Override public int getWidth( ) {
return isFixedSize ? _myWidth : _myFontLabel.getWidth( );
}
@Override public int getHeight( ) {
return _myFontLabel.getHeight( );
}
@Override public int getOverflow( ) {
return -1;
}
@Override public String getTextFormatted( ) {
return ( isToUpperCase ? _myText.toUpperCase( ) : _myText );
}
}
